Output 3fa37fe392a0be5618259fa499261bd11c250b3f6bfd217f194990100980bf65:4

value
19819900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19655830e791807ced050b8f0032b61d9a5c8979 OP_EQUAL
address
MADSXmKguLpWtonfD9krkmRQTvigELzRLg
transaction
3fa37fe392a0be5618259fa499261bd11c250b3f6bfd217f194990100980bf65
spent
true